(57) A dishwashing machine is described, of the type capable of executing a plurality
of different wash programs (standard wash cycle, intensive wash cycle, economy wash
cycle, etc.) selectively selectable by the user, said programs comprising a plurality
of sequential phases (prewash, main wash, rinses, etc.), among which at least a main
wash phase during which a detergent distribution is provided in the machine wash tub
(C), wherein said distribution is obtained through a washing agents dispenser (1)
comprising at least a recess (4) equipped with a small closing lid (5) to contain
said detergent required for said wash phase. According to the invention, said dispenser
(1) comprises means (8-11; 5A,5B,5C) for determining the introduction in said tub
(C) of a portion of said detergent contained in said recess (4) during at least an
operative phase, of the wash program selected among the available ones, temporally
preceding said main wash phase, said operative phase being in particular the initial
phase provided by the selected wash program.
